PACKAGING
FILM
Chemical Coated Films
These
packaging films have one-side chemical treatment. These are also
available with corona treatment on the other side. These films
possess good thermal, optical, frictional properties, excellent
processability and show much enhanced adhesion to inks, metal,
coatings and adhesives over other films and meets customer’s most
of the requirements of packaging. These films are suitable for
high quality printing and metallising applications.
LI
or AI – chemical wound-inside LO
or AO – chemical wound-outside
CIL
– corona wound-in, chemical wound-out COL
– corona wound-out, chemical wound-in

FDA
Status : This UmaPET polyester film complies with U.S. Food and
Drug Administration food additive regulation 21 CFR 177.1630, sections
(f) and (g).
UmaPETÒis
the registered trademark for Ester Industries’ bi-axially oriented
polyester films based on polyethylene terephthalate.
